@larabee WEG 1.3.5 fixes DRM problems with Catalina so people should be happy again as soon as it comes out... :hysterical: :hysterical:

 

WhateverGreen Changelog

v1.3.5

  • Dropped legacy boot arguments (-shikigva, -shikifps)
  • Fixed handling agdpmod GPU property (in IGPUs and in conjunction with boot-arg)
  • Added -wegtree boot argument to force device renaming
  • Fixed FairPlay DRM playback patches on 10.15
  • Added shikigva and shiki-id aliases in IORegistry

I do the same thing. Put your nVidia card in your PCI slot 2, and add this SSDT to your ACPI/patched folder (where the DSDT.aml is). This will prevent the nVidia card from showing up on your macOS side.

SSDT-Z390-Disable-Slot-2-GPU.aml
